Written in honour of the Animal Liberation Movement around the world, HUMPY AND THE HUMPBACK WHALES is the heart-warming and real-life experiences of the Humpback Pod of whales that swim across the oceans throughout their lifetime- in what is known as the longest migration of any mammal. Right from singing their happy whale songs and talking to each other, breaching and leaping out of the ocean and learning to hunt their prey in techniques known only to the Humpbacks, the whales enjoy their exotic lifestyle, until of course, little Humpy realizes the constant, lurking and unbeatable danger of Human Whalers. Poaching has made the whales one of the most endangered species that exist. These beautiful creatures will only thrive as long as we, humans, allow them to. Kids anywhere between the ages of 5 to 12 will enjoy this illustrated book and find meaning in anti-poaching activities.
